[Xen-users] Question about adding CPU/RAM to Windows DomU
 
I have a DomU(HVM) installed with Windows
2003 server. I try to add ram and cpu dynamically (tried both virsh and xm),
the command has no error. But in Windows, I cannot see the changes. Finally I
rebooted the Windows, and then ram/cpu are adjusted. I want to know it is
limitation of Windows? Or Xen HVM? 
  
If using para-virtualization method, I can
add ram/cpu dynamically to the para-virtualized Linux DomU.
